Mont Saint Michel and its Bay (France) Tipo de documento Decision Número de referencia VI.40 Fecha Jun 7, 1991 FuenteUNEP, InforMEA Estado Activo Materia Especies silvestres y ecosistemas Tratado Convención para la Protección del Patrimonio Mundial, Cultural y Natural (Nov 23, 1972) Reunión 15e session du Bureau Página web whc.unesco.org Resumen The Secretariat had indicated that it had received, and passed on to the French authorities, another letter from a French association for the protection of the environment drawing attention to potential dangers to this site arising from two projects: the construction of an industrial pig farm and the opening of a leisure park. In reply, the French observer assured the Bureau that neither of these two projects had been authorized, and that the extension and protection of the Mont Saint Michel site was under way at the national level. The Bureau took note of these assurances with satisfaction.
